开源AI助理新星崛起:从概念到效率革命的深度解析

一、技术定位:从”对话窗口”到”系统级智能中枢”

传统AI助理多局限于网页端或独立应用内的文本交互,而Clawdbot通过系统级集成实现三大突破:

  1. 跨软件操作能力
    基于操作系统级API调用,可同时操控代码编辑器、终端、浏览器等工具链。例如开发者口述”在IDE中打开项目,运行单元测试,并将结果发送到协作平台”,Clawdbot可自动分解为多步骤操作并执行。

  2. 上下文感知引擎
    采用多模态输入解析技术,支持语音/文本混合指令输入。通过分析当前工作区状态(如打开的文件、终端历史、浏览器标签页),动态调整任务优先级。测试数据显示,在复杂开发场景下指令解析准确率达92.3%。

  3. 自动化工作流编排
    内置可视化工作流设计器,开发者可通过自然语言定义条件分支。例如设置”当CI流水线失败时,自动生成错误报告并@相关人员”的触发规则,减少重复性运维工作。

二、技术架构解析:开源生态的模块化创新

项目采用微服务架构设计,核心组件包括:

  1. 指令解析层
    基于Transformer架构的语义理解模型,支持中英文混合指令解析。通过预训练模型+领域知识库的混合架构,在代码相关指令上表现尤为突出。示例指令:

    1. "用FastAPI重构当前模块,添加JWT认证,并生成Postman测试集合"
  2. 操作执行层
    采用插件化设计,已支持主流开发工具的API对接:

    • 代码编辑器:VS Code/JetBrains系列
    • 版本控制:Git命令自动化
    • 云服务:对象存储/容器平台通用接口
    • 协作工具:即时通讯/项目管理平台
  3. 反馈优化机制
    通过用户行为日志分析持续优化模型,采用强化学习框架提升任务完成率。早期版本在处理复杂指令时需人工干预,经过3个迭代周期后自主完成率提升至85%。

三、效率革命:开发模式的范式转变

  1. 从”手写代码”到”意图驱动开发”
    传统开发流程需经历需求分析→设计→编码→测试的线性过程,而Clawdbot支持直接表达业务意图。例如:

    1. "创建一个用户管理系统,包含注册/登录/权限管理功能,使用React前端+Django后端"

    系统可自动生成项目结构、基础代码和测试用例,开发者仅需关注核心业务逻辑。

  2. 多任务并行处理能力
    通过异步任务队列和资源调度算法,可同时处理多个开发请求。测试场景中,系统在10分钟内完成了:

    • 环境搭建(容器化部署)
    • 代码生成(基于模板引擎)
    • 持续集成配置
    • 文档自动化生成
  3. 知识沉淀与复用
    内置企业知识库接口,可自动关联内部文档、API规范等资源。当开发者输入”调用支付接口”时,系统不仅生成代码,还会附加:

    • 接口签名规范
    • 沙箱环境测试指南
    • 常见错误处理方案

四、开源生态的挑战与机遇

  1. 技术门槛与社区协作
    项目初期面临操作系统兼容性、安全沙箱等挑战。通过建立开发者贡献指南和自动化测试框架,目前已吸引全球开发者提交200+插件,覆盖主流开发工具链。

  2. 大模型融合趋势
    第二代版本将集成多模态大模型,支持:

    • 代码注释自动生成
    • 架构图可视化
    • 漏洞自动修复建议
      测试数据显示,结合代码大模型后,复杂任务完成时间缩短63%。
  3. 企业级部署方案
    针对生产环境需求,提供:

    • 私有化部署容器镜像
    • 细粒度权限控制系统
    • 审计日志与操作回溯
      某金融企业测试案例显示,部署后开发效率提升40%,运维成本降低25%。

五、未来展望:智能开发时代的基础设施

随着技术演进,Clawdbot可能向三个方向发展:

  1. 垂直领域深化
    针对AI开发、区块链等特殊场景提供定制化插件市场,形成技术栈闭环。

  2. 低代码平台融合
    与可视化开发工具结合,实现”自然语言→低代码→可执行代码”的三级转换。

  3. 开发者大脑延伸
    通过脑机接口等前沿技术,实现思维级意图捕捉,彻底解放双手编码。

结语:Clawdbot的崛起标志着AI助理从辅助工具向生产力平台的质变。其开源特性降低了技术门槛,而模块化设计为个性化定制提供了可能。对于开发者而言,这不仅是效率工具的革新,更是开发思维模式的升级——从”如何实现”到”实现什么”的范式转变正在发生。